summaryrefslogtreecommitdiff
path: root/chat/amsn
diff options
context:
space:
mode:
authorjoerg <joerg>2007-08-30 13:05:45 +0000
committerjoerg <joerg>2007-08-30 13:05:45 +0000
commitcdde8ab468f0f51028924858ee6eed2354d664bb (patch)
treec4c8bc4e15e4dd3920a2175b05620a96160da5b0 /chat/amsn
parent1f6e864ee4ba205b06c002a6f34a92be8c269562 (diff)
downloadpkgsrc-cdde8ab468f0f51028924858ee6eed2354d664bb.tar.gz
Fix interpreter pathes and add dependency on Perl and bash as
they are used. Bump revision.
Diffstat (limited to 'chat/amsn')
-rw-r--r--chat/amsn/Makefile37
1 files changed, 28 insertions, 9 deletions
diff --git a/chat/amsn/Makefile b/chat/amsn/Makefile
index ca9be4c4907..a14a263e7fb 100644
--- a/chat/amsn/Makefile
+++ b/chat/amsn/Makefile
@@ -1,9 +1,9 @@
-# $NetBSD: Makefile,v 1.8 2007/05/18 10:03:30 peter Exp $
+# $NetBSD: Makefile,v 1.9 2007/08/30 13:05:45 joerg Exp $
#
DISTNAME= amsn-0_94
PKGNAME= ${DISTNAME:S/_/./}
-PKGREVISION= 2
+PKGREVISION= 3
CATEGORIES= chat
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=amsn/}
@@ -11,17 +11,36 @@ MAINTAINER= pkgsrc-users@NetBSD.org
HOMEPAGE= http://www.amsn-project.net/
COMMENT= "Alvaro's MSN messenger client"
-NO_CONFIGURE= YES
+PKG_DESTDIR_SUPPORT= user-destdir
+
NO_BUILD= YES
INSTALLATION_DIRS= bin
+USE_TOOLS+= perl:run bash:run
+
+REPLACE_INTERPRETER+= sys-WISH
+REPLACE.sys-WISH.old= .*wish
+REPLACE.sys-WISH.new= ${PREFIX}/bin/wish
+REPLACE_FILES.sys-WISH= alarm.tcl blocking.tcl skins.tcl amsn-remote
+
+REPLACE_INTERPRETER+= sys-TCLSH
+REPLACE.sys-TCLSH.old= .*tclsh
+REPLACE.sys-TCLSH.new= ${PREFIX}/bin/tclsh
+REPLACE_FILES.sys-TCLSH=amsn-remote-CLI lang/convert.tcl
+
+REPLACE_PERL= utils/amsnctl.pl lang/complete.pl
+REPLACE_BASH= utils/update-amsn.sh
+
+INSTALLATION_DIRS= share/amsn share/pixmaps
+
+do-configure:
+ @${DO_NADA}
+
do-install:
- ${INSTALL_DATA_DIR} ${PREFIX}/share/amsn
- ${CP} -R ${WRKSRC}/* ${PREFIX}/share/amsn
- ${INSTALL_DATA_DIR} ${PREFIX}/share/pixmaps
- ${CP} -R ${WRKSRC}/icons/32x32/* ${PREFIX}/share/pixmaps
- ${LN} -sf ${PREFIX}/share/amsn/amsn ${PREFIX}/bin/amsn
- ${CHMOD} +x ${PREFIX}/share/amsn/amsn
+ ${CP} -R ${WRKSRC}/* ${DESTDIR}${PREFIX}/share/amsn
+ ${CP} -R ${WRKSRC}/icons/32x32/* ${DESTDIR}${PREFIX}/share/pixmaps
+ ${LN} -sf ${PREFIX}/share/amsn/amsn ${DESTDIR}${PREFIX}/bin/amsn
+ ${CHMOD} +x ${DESTDIR}${PREFIX}/share/amsn/amsn
.include "../../security/tcl-tls/buildlink3.mk"
.include "../../lang/tcl/buildlink3.mk"